BMW DISA Valve Failure Warning Signs
BMW DISA valve failure can sometimes begin with an unusual intake rattle long before the driver notices a serious loss of power. The engine may still start normally, idle reasonably, and accelerate without obvious problems, yet persistent noise from the intake area can indicate excessive play or wear in the DISA mechanism. Because the system helps control airflow at different engine speeds, a small mechanical fault can gradually affect torque delivery, throttle response, or engine smoothness.
Early inspection is therefore worthwhile: similar noises can come from other components, so the goal is to identify whether the DISA valve itself has developed a mechanical problem. DISA is part of BMW’s variable intake system. It changes the effective intake path according to engine operating conditions. Understanding how an intake system works can also help explain why a problem with an intake-control component can affect engine response.
When the mechanism works correctly, the flap remains properly positioned and the shaft moves without excessive play. Wear can disturb this relationship. A loose flap, worn shaft, or damaged internal component may prevent the valve from holding its intended position, changing airflow and reducing the consistency of engine response.

These symptoms can be subtle. A driver who uses the same vehicle every day may notice only that it feels “different” rather than immediately identifying a specific mechanical fault.
That is why a change in character can be useful diagnostic information. The engine does not have to stop running for an intake-control component to warrant inspection.
An intake rattle alone is not enough to confirm DISA failure. Other components, intake leaks, ignition faults, sens ors, or vacuum problems can create similar symptoms. A combination of mechanical and electronic clues provides a more reliable basis for inspection.
Mechanical play is particularly important. If the flap or shaft moves beyond the range expected for the design, internal wear may have developed. A technician may also find worn bushings, damaged seals, cracks, distorted parts, or other visible deterioration.
Fault codes can support the diagnosis, but they should not automatically be treated as proof that the DISA valve is defective. The surrounding intake system also needs to be checked.

The reason for this broader approach is simple: replacing the wrong component will not solve the underlying problem.
A worn DISA valve does not automatically make the entire assembly unusable. If the housing and main structure remain sound, the fault may be limited to a few replaceable internal components. A targeted rebuild can therefore be a practical alternative when inspection confirms that the original assembly is suitable for restoration.

Dimensional accuracy and material suitability are important because the mechanism operates in a hot, vibrating engine environment. Seals also require attention, since damaged sealing can introduce unwanted air and leave the original problem unresolved. A repair is effective only when it addresses the actual weak point rather than simply replacing a visible symptom.
